Por que o nginx -v não exibe a versão no ubuntu12.04?

1

O Nginx foi instalado no nosso servidor Ubuntu 12.04 e queremos encontrar a versão. Aqui está o que fizemos:

admin@ibm-testbox:/opt/nginx/sbin$ nginx -v
The program 'nginx' can be found in the following packages:
 * nginx-extras
 * nginx-full
 * nginx-light
 * nginx-naxsi
Try: sudo apt-get install <selected package>
admin@ibm-testbox:/opt/nginx/sbin$ nginx -V
The program 'nginx' can be found in the following packages:
 * nginx-extras
 * nginx-full
 * nginx-light
 * nginx-naxsi
Try: sudo apt-get install <selected package>

Então, estávamos tentando descobrir se o nginx estava em execução. Aqui está a saída:

admin@ibm-testbox:/opt/nginx/sbin$ ps waux | grep nginx
root      7652  0.0  0.0  37560  1100 ?        Ss   Dec20   0:00 nginx: master process /opt/nginx/sbin/nginx
nobody    7653  0.0  0.0  38008  2316 ?        S    Dec20   0:00 nginx: worker process
admin  23376  0.0  0.0   9388   924 pts/0    S+   08:35   0:00 grep --color=auto nginx

O nginx foi instalado com o módulo PhusionPassenger. Por que nginx -v (-V) não mostrou a versão?

    
por user938363 21.12.2013 / 15:59

1 resposta

0

Parece que o nginx não está instalado corretamente. Você pode reinstalar o nginx por

apt-get purge nginx*
apt-get autoremove
apt-get update
apt-get install nginx-full

Além disso, você pode tentar easyengine para instalar e gerenciar o site no servidor ubuntu.

    
por Mitesh Shah 23.12.2013 / 11:58